What is MCA in cyber?

MCA stands for Master of Computer Application, which is a postgraduate degree in computer science and related fields. The MCA degree specializes in various domains, including Cyber Security and Forensics, which focuses on protecting computer systems and networks from unauthorized access and malicious attacks. Here are some key features of MCA in Cyber Security and Forensics:

  • Comprehensive Curriculum: MCA in Cyber Security and Forensics covers a wide range of topics, including computer networks, cryptography, information security, cyber laws, digital forensics, and incident response. The program is designed to provide students with a strong foundation in both theoretical and practical aspects of cybersecurity.
  • Industry-relevant Skills: The MCA program in Cyber Security and Forensics equips students with industry-relevant skills that enable them to identify, prevent, and mitigate cybersecurity threats. This includes skills in risk assessment, vulnerability assessment and management, penetration testing, and security audits.
  • Hands-on Experience: The MCA program in Cyber Security and Forensics emphasizes hands-on experience through projects, internships, and practical assignments. Students get exposure to real-world scenarios and learn how to apply their knowledge to solve complex cybersecurity challenges.
  • Career Opportunities: The demand for cybersecurity professionals is on the rise, and MCA graduates in Cyber Security and Forensics have excellent career prospects. They can work as cybersecurity analysts, information security managers, security consultants, network administrators, and forensic investigators, among other roles.

    Overview of MCA in Cyber Security and Forensics

    Master of Computer Application (MCA) in Cyber Security and Forensics is a specialized postgraduate course that focuses on the application of computer technology and network security in preventing cyber-attacks. The program combines theoretical knowledge with practical skills and is designed to equip students with the technical skills required to detect and investigate cybercrimes. The program is structured to provide students with an in-depth understanding of security technologies, cyber threats, and forensic investigation techniques.

    The program is designed for students who have completed their undergraduate degree in computer science or a related field and are looking to advance their knowledge and career opportunities in the cybersecurity industry. The course duration is typically three years, and it covers a range of subjects including cybersecurity principles, ethical hacking, cryptography, digital forensics, and network security.

    Core Curriculum of MCA in Cyber Security and Forensics

    The core curriculum of the MCA in Cyber Security and Forensics covers a wide range of subjects that are critical to the field of cybersecurity. Some of the key subjects that are covered in the program include:

    • Cybersecurity Principles
    • Information Security Management
    • Computer Networks and Cyber Defense
    • Ethical Hacking and Penetration Testing
    • Network Security Management
    • Cryptography and Information Security
    • Digital Forensics and Incident Response
    • Cyber Threat Intelligence and Analytics
    • Cyber Law and Regulations

    The program also includes hands-on training and practical projects that allow students to apply the theoretical knowledge gained in the classroom to real-world scenarios.

    Job Opportunities with MCA in Cyber Security and Forensics

    Graduates of the MCA in Cyber Security and Forensics can expect to have excellent job opportunities in a variety of cybersecurity-related roles. Some of the job roles that graduates can pursue include:

    • Information Security Analyst
    • Cybersecurity Analyst
    • Network Security Engineer
    • Ethical Hacker
    • Digital Forensic Analyst
    • Cybersecurity Consultant
    • Chief Information Security Officer

    The salaries for these roles range from INR 4-12 lakhs per annum depending on the skills, experience, and location of the candidate.

    Entrance Requirements for MCA in Cyber Security and Forensics

    To be eligible for MCA in Cyber Security and Forensics, candidates must have completed their undergraduate degree with a minimum of 50% marks in computer science or a related field. Additionally, some universities require candidates to have a valid score in an entrance exam such as the Common Entrance Test (CET).
